MACON, IL (April 30, 2015) Jimmy Owens scored his first Lucas Oil Late Model Dirt Series win of the season on Thursday Night at Macon Speedway.  Owens inherited the lead when race-long front-runners Bobby Pierce and Billy Moyer pitted to change flat tires.  Owens then led the rest of the way to win the St. Louis U-Pic-A-Part 100.

Trailing Owens to the finish line were Jason Feger, Devon Moran, Shannon Babb, and Ryan Unzicker.

“It feels great to get the first Lucas Oil Series win for Bryan Rowland.  We learned a lot from last year running here and we made the proper changes tonight and got the job done,” said Owens, who collected his 53rd career LOLMDS victory.

“We came here last year for the first time in a late model.  We nearly got lapped early on by Bobby [Pierce], but we made our way back to finish third.  Tonight, I guess Pierce and Moyer cut down tires and that left the door open for us.  You have to hit that turn three and four at an angle to scotch it off.  It worked out pretty good.”

Pierce and Moyer battled back and forth for the lead several times as lapped traffic was causing Pierce issues.  Pierce had led the first 20 laps until Moyer took the lead on lap 21.  Pierce fought back and retook the point on lap 32.

Pierce and Moyer ran one-two until a fateful caution on lap 58 as both drivers would go pit side with flat right rear tires.  Owens then inherited lead and held on till the end.

“I would like to thank Widow Wax Car Care Products, Sunoco Race Fuels, Red Line Oil, Keyser Manufacturing, Ford, Midwest Sheet Metal, Cornett Engines, and Club 29 Race Cars.  It is a great way to start the weekend.”

Feger, who has ran a limited schedule thus far in 2015 was happy with his second-place finish.  “I am tickled to death with this run.  After coming back from a broken arm, we have had bad luck so far, but this makes it a whole lot better,” said the driver of the Cheap Cars, Pro Tire and Automotive, Griffin Sign Shop, and Titan #25.

Moran made his first appearance at Macon and came home third in the final rundown.  “I have to thank Jerry Hupp for getting us to come over here.  We weren’t going to come, but he wanted us over here.  To place third against this stacked field is just tremendous.  We have never been here, and it was fun.”

Completing the top ten were Chris Brown, Brandon Sheppard, Bobby Pierce, Don O’Neal, and Eddie Carrier Jr.

In preliminary action, Billy Moyer set the overall Miller Welders Fast Time (Group A) amongst the 30 entrants, with a lap of 10.228 seconds. Bobby Pierce set the fastest time in Group B with a time of 10.558 seconds. Billy Moyer, Jimmy Owens, Bobby Pierce, and Brandon Sheppard won their respective heat races. Devin Moran and Jonathan Davenport won their respective B-Mains.
